When picking a treadmill, it's vital to consider several elements to guarantee you are picking the very [best treadmills](https://pattern-wiki.win/wiki/Think_Youre_The_Perfect_Candidate_For_Treadmill_Buy_Take_This_Quiz) model for your needs. Here's a list of vital features to search for:
Motor Power: The motor's horsepower (HP) is important for efficiency. A motor with 2.5 HP or greater is recommended for running.Belt Size: A longer and wider belt provides more [space saving treadmill](https://telegra.ph/10-Unexpected-Best-Home-Treadmill-UK-Tips-01-14) for comfy running. A minimum length of 55 inches and a width of 20 inches prevails.Slope Options: Incline settings simulate outdoor running and can boost workout intensity.Cushioning: Look for models with shock absorption systems to minimize the influence on joints.Weight Capacity: Ensure the treadmill can accommodate your weight.Display Console: A clear console with easy-to-read metrics for tracking workouts can improve your physical fitness experience.Warranty: A great warranty can protect your investment. There are mostly two types of treadmills available for home use: handbook and motorized. Here's a brief introduction of each:
1. Manual TreadmillsPros: Typically more economical, portable, and need no electrical power.Cons: Limited functions and not suitable for high-intensity workouts.2. Motorized TreadmillsPros: Offer various speeds, slope options, and integrated exercise programs; more comfortable for extended use.Cons: Generally more pricey and need a source of power.Popular Treadmill Brands

Just how much should I invest on a treadmill?
Treadmill costs can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 3,000. For a great quality design, expect to spend between ₤ 800 to ₤ 1,500.
2. What is the life-span of a treadmill?
Typically, a treadmill can last between 7 to 12 years if effectively kept.

5. Exist any maintenance tips for a treadmill?
Routinely clean the surface, examine the belt positioning, lubricate the belt as required, and make sure that all parts are functioning correctly to extend the treadmill's life.
